Standout Feature

Advanced dynamic allocation engine that intelligently determines stand-alone selling prices using market data, cost-plus, and expected cost methods

Oracle Revenue Management Cloud is a leading enterprise solution within Oracle Fusion Cloud ERP designed to automate complex revenue recognition processes in full compliance with ASC 606 and IFRS 15 standards. It handles contract lifecycle management, performance obligations, transaction price allocation, and revenue recognition over time or at points in time with high accuracy. The platform offers real-time visibility, advanced analytics, and seamless integration with other Oracle financial modules, reducing manual efforts and ensuring audit-ready reporting.

Pros

  • Comprehensive automation for complex multi-element contracts and performance obligations
  • Robust compliance tools with full audit trails and support for global standards like ASC 606/IFRS 15
  • Deep integration with Oracle ERP ecosystem and AI-driven insights for forecasting

Cons

  • High implementation and subscription costs unsuitable for small businesses
  • Steep learning curve requiring specialized training for optimal use
  • Best suited for Oracle-centric environments, limiting flexibility for non-Oracle users

Best For

Large enterprises with complex, high-volume revenue contracts needing scalable, compliant automation.

Standout Feature

Event-driven revenue recognition engine that automates postings and adjustments based on contract milestones and real-time events

SAP Revenue Accounting and Reporting (RAR) is an enterprise-grade solution that automates revenue recognition processes in full compliance with IFRS 15 and ASC 606 standards. It manages complex customer contracts, performance obligations, revenue allocation, and deferrals across multi-element arrangements. Integrated natively with SAP S/4HANA and ERP systems, it enables real-time revenue reporting, analytics, and audit trails for large-scale financial operations.

Pros

  • Seamless compliance with IFRS 15/ASC 606 and robust handling of complex contracts
  • Deep integration with SAP ecosystem for automated data flow and real-time insights
  • Advanced analytics, simulation tools, and comprehensive audit reporting

Cons

  • Steep learning curve and complex implementation requiring SAP expertise
  • High licensing and customization costs
  • Less intuitive UI compared to modern SaaS alternatives

Best For

Large enterprises with SAP infrastructure needing automated revenue recognition for intricate, high-volume contracts.

Standout Feature

Automated performance obligation tracking and rule-based revenue scheduling engine

NetSuite SuiteRevenue is a powerful revenue recognition module integrated into the Oracle NetSuite ERP platform, designed to automate complex revenue scheduling and compliance with standards like ASC 606 and IFRS 15. It handles multi-element arrangements, performance obligations, variable consideration, and contract amendments, streamlining the order-to-cash process. The solution provides real-time visibility into deferred revenue, recognition schedules, and financial reporting directly within NetSuite's unified system.

Pros

  • Seamless integration with NetSuite ERP for end-to-end automation
  • Robust handling of complex contracts and compliance standards
  • Scalable for enterprise-level volume and global operations

Cons

  • Steep learning curve and requires NetSuite expertise
  • High cost tied to full NetSuite subscription
  • Limited flexibility outside the NetSuite ecosystem

Best For

Mid-to-large enterprises using NetSuite ERP that manage complex, multi-element sales contracts requiring ASC 606/IFRS 15 compliance.

Standout Feature

Automated handling of usage-based and hybrid subscription models with dynamic deferred revenue waterfalls

Chargebee Revenue Recognition is an integrated module within the Chargebee subscription management platform that automates revenue recognition for SaaS and subscription businesses in compliance with ASC 606 and IFRS 15. It handles complex scenarios like multi-element arrangements, usage-based billing, and deferred revenue schedules by generating accurate journal entries and reports. The tool seamlessly syncs with Chargebee's billing data and exports to accounting systems such as NetSuite, QuickBooks, and Xero, streamlining financial close processes.

Pros

  • Seamless integration with Chargebee billing for real-time data sync
  • Strong compliance with ASC 606/IFRS 15 including performance obligations
  • Automated journal exports and audit-ready reports

Cons

  • Best suited for existing Chargebee users; limited standalone value
  • Configuration can be complex for non-subscription revenue streams
  • Bundled pricing may feel steep for smaller teams focused only on recognition

Best For

SaaS and subscription businesses already using Chargebee billing who need automated, compliant revenue recognition tightly integrated with their invoicing.
